IndependenceTest

IndependenceTest[v1,v2]

检验向量 v1v2 是否独立.

IndependenceTest[m1,m2]

检验矩阵 m1m2 是否独立.

IndependenceTest[,"property"]

返回 "property" 的值.

更多信息和选项

  • IndependenceTestv1v2 进行假设检验,其中零假设 假定向量是独立的,而备择假设 认为并非如此.
  • 默认情况下,返回一个概率值或者 值.
  • 一个较小的 值表明 不可能为真.
  • 参数 v1v2 可以是任意实值向量或者等长矩阵.
  • IndependenceTest[v1,v2] 将对 v1v2 选择最有效的检验方法.
  • IndependenceTest[v1,v2,All] 将选择所有可以应用于 v1v2 的检验.
  • IndependenceTest[v1,v2,"test"] 根据 "test" 的结果报告 值.
  • 某些可用检验对假定 vi 是正态的. 某些检验局限于向量. 大多数检验局限于单调性检验或者线性独立性.
  • 可以使用下列检验:
  • "BlomqvistBeta"单调基于 Blomqvist
    "GoodmanKruskalGamma"单调,向量基于 -系数
    "HoeffdingD"向量基于 Hoeffding
    "KendallTau"单调基于 Kendall
    "PearsonCorrelation"线性,正态性,向量基于 Pearson 乘积矩
    "PillaiTrace"正态性,线性基于 Pillai 的迹
    "SpearmanRank"单调基于 Spearman
    "WilksW"正态性,线性基于 Wilks'
  • IndependenceTest[v1,v2,"HypothesisTestData"] 返回一个 HypothesisTestData 对象 htd,该对象可利用形式 htd["property"] 提取额外的检验结果和属性.
  • IndependenceTest[v1,v2,"property"] 可被用于直接给出 "property" 的值.
  • 与检验结果报告相关的属性包括:
  • "AllTests"所有适用的检验的列表
    "AutomaticTest"如果使用 Automatic 所选择的检验
    "DegreesOfFreedom"检验中使用的自由度
    "PValue" 值列表
    "PValueTable" 值的格式化表格
    "ShortTestConclusion"检验结论的简短说明
    "TestConclusion"检验结论的描述
    "TestData"检验统计量和 值对的列表
    "TestDataTable" 值和检验统计量组成的格式化表格
    "TestStatistic"检验统计量列表
    "TestStatisticTable"检验统计量的格式化表格
  • 可以使用下列选项:
  • AlternativeHypothesis "Unequal"备择假设的不等式
    MaxIterations Automatic多变量非参数检验的最大迭代次数
    Method Automatic用于计算 值的方法
    SignificanceLevel 0.05诊断和报告的临界值
    VerifyTestAssumptions Automatic验证何种假定
  • 对于一个独立性检验,选择一个临界值 ,使得只有当 时才否定 . 用于 "TestConclusion""ShortTestConclusion" 属性的 值由 SignificanceLevel 选项控制. 值也用于正态性诊断. 默认情况下, 设为 0.05.
  • IndependenceTestVerifyTestAssumptions 的已命名设置包括:
  • "Normality"验证是否所有数据都服从正态分布

范例

打开所有单元关闭所有单元

基本范例  (2)

检验两个向量是否独立:

检验两个矩阵是否独立:

0.05 水平上,没有足够的证据来拒绝独立性:

范围  (12)

检验  (8)

检验两个向量是否独立:

当向量彼此独立时,其 值一般较大:

当向量彼此相关时,其 值一般较小:

检验两个矩阵是否独立:

当矩阵不独立时,其 值一般较小:

当矩阵独立时,其 值一般较大:

使用 Automatic 应用最有效的适当的线性独立检验:

属性 "AutomaticTest" 可被用于确定所选择的检验:

执行特定的独立性检验:

可以同时进行任意数目的检验:

同时执行所有适用于数据的检验:

使用属性 "AllTests" 识别所用的检验:

为重复的属性提取创建一个 HypothesisTestData 对象:

可用于提取的属性:

HypothesisTestData 对象中提取一些属性:

来自 "PearsonCorrelation" 检验的 值和检验统计量:

同时提取任意数目的属性:

来自 Spearman 秩检验的 值和检验统计量:

报告  (4)

对选取的一组检验的结果制表:

所有适当检验结果的完整表格:

选取部分检验结果的表格:

取回自定义报告的检验表中的条目:

值高于 0.05,因此在该水平下拒绝 的证据不足:

对一个或一组检验的 值制表:

表格中的 值:

所用适当检验的 值表:

来自检验子集的 值表:

对一个或一组检验的检验统计量制表:

来自表格的检验统计量:

所有适当检验的检验统计量表格:

选项  (15)

AlternativeHypothesis  (3)

在默认情况下进行双边检验:

进行双边检验或单边检验:

双边检验:

作为替代方法的两个单边检验:

某些检验固有的是双边的:

这是由于零分布的形状:

MaxIterations  (1)

设置用于多变量非参数检验的最大迭代次数:

把此值设置得太低可能导致收敛失败,但是产生更快的计时:

Method  (4)

默认情况下,使用渐进检验统计分布来计算 值:

使用置换方法可以得到 值:

设置使用的置换数目:

默认情况下,使用 个随机置换:

设置用于生成随机置换的种子:

SignificanceLevel  (3)

设置诊断检验的显著性水平:

默认使用 0.05. 消息显示 0.025,这是因为进行了两个检验:

显著性水平的设置可能会改变自动选择的检验:

默认情况下会选择非参数检验:

该显著性水平也用于 "TestConclusion""ShortTestConclusion"

VerifyTestAssumptions  (4)

默认情况下,在适当的时候会测试正态性:

诊断程序可以利用 AllNone 作为一个组进行控制:

验证所有假设:

不检查假设:

诊断程序可被独立控制:

检查正态性:

显式设置诊断结果:

为了进行模拟,忽视诊断检验通常是有用的:

设计中已经使用了检验假设,所以可以节省大量时间:

结果是相同的:

属性和关系  (4)

所选检验取决于正态假设和数据的维度:

正态分布向量的比较:

第二个向量不是来自正态分布:

正态分布数据的矩阵比较:

数据的矩阵比较不是正态分布的:

若要检验相关性或者阶数相关性的特定值,使用 CorrelationTest

如果有非线性独立性,应该使用 HoeffdingDTest

数据明显是相关的:

默认情况下,IndependenceTest 并不检测这些:

默认情况下,选择单调独立性测量:

HoeffdingD 对多种类型的独立性敏感:

IndependenceTest 适用于仅仅由值组成的时间序列 TimeSeries

巧妙范例  (1)

某些检验统计量的分布:

Wolfram Research (2012),IndependenceTest,Wolfram 语言函数,https://reference.wolfram.com/language/ref/IndependenceTest.html.

文本

Wolfram Research (2012),IndependenceTest,Wolfram 语言函数,https://reference.wolfram.com/language/ref/IndependenceTest.html.

CMS

Wolfram 语言. 2012. "IndependenceTest." Wolfram 语言与系统参考资料中心. Wolfram Research. https://reference.wolfram.com/language/ref/IndependenceTest.html.

APA

Wolfram 语言. (2012). IndependenceTest. Wolfram 语言与系统参考资料中心. 追溯自 https://reference.wolfram.com/language/ref/IndependenceTest.html 年

BibTeX

@misc{reference.wolfram_2024_independencetest, author="Wolfram Research", title="{IndependenceTest}", year="2012", howpublished="\url{https://reference.wolfram.com/language/ref/IndependenceTest.html}", note=[Accessed: 14-November-2024 ]}

BibLaTeX

@online{reference.wolfram_2024_independencetest, organization={Wolfram Research}, title={IndependenceTest}, year={2012}, url={https://reference.wolfram.com/language/ref/IndependenceTest.html}, note=[Accessed: 14-November-2024 ]}